In the Phase 2b VESPER program, weekly dosing achieved ~16% weight loss with no plateau through 32 weeks, successful transition to monthly maintenance, and favorable GI tolerability validating the feasibility of monthly GLP1 therapy

106 HIF signaling pathway Hypoxia-inducible factors (HIFs), consisting of an oxygen-sensitive subunit and a constitutively expressed HIF-1 subunit, are major regulators of adaptive responses to hypoxia and directly activate the expression of multiple target genes to maintain cellular oxygen homeostasis
